Answer:

[tex]y=\frac{5}{4}x+7[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

We can start by setting up what we know of the slope-intercept equation, which is the slope.

[tex]y=\frac{5}{4}x+b[/tex]

Now, we can use the given point to find the y-intercept.

[tex]2=\frac{5}{4}(-4)+b\\ 2=-5+b\\b=7[/tex]

And now we are able to write the slope-intercept equation.

[tex]y=\frac{5}{4}x+7[/tex]
